FOUNTAIN, Colo. — A transgendered first-grader who was born a boy but identifies as a girl has won the right to use the girls’ restroom at her Colorado school.
The Colorado rights division ruled in favor of Coy Mathis in her fight against the Fountain-Fort Carson School District.
Coy’s parents had taken her case to the commission after the district said she could no longer use the girls bathroom at Eagleside Elementary.
The state’s rights division decided keeping the ban in place, quote, “creates an environment that is objectively and subjectively hostile, intimidating or offensive.”
